Two people arrested over 12-day-old baby boy mauled to death by dog in Doncaster

Two people have been arrested on suspicion of manslaughter by gross negligence after a newborn baby died from injuries sustained in a dog attack.

Emergency services were called to Woodlands in Doncaster on Sunday afternoon following reports the infant - who was 12-days-old - had been attacked by a dog.

The baby was rushed to hospital but sadly pronounced dead a short time later, the Doncaster Free Press reports.

South Yorkshire Police has confirmed that a man and woman have been arrested in connection with the child's death.

A brief statement from the force today (Tuesday) said: “Police were called to an address on Welfare Road at around 3.30pm on Sunday following reports that a dog had attacked a child.

"On arrival at the property, emergency services discovered a 12-day-old baby boy had been bitten by a dog and suffered serious injuries. The child was taken to hospital, but sadly died a short time later.

"A 35-year-old man and a 27-year-old woman have been arrested on suspicion of gross negligence manslaughter. They have now been bailed while enquiries continue.”

The dog has been removed from the address.
